Transaction 5093e9758607d2f342165161690f40b19c4be562495e9430a9edbbe1b5d3b9c8
1 Input
1 Output
-
5093e9758607d2f342165161690f40b19c4be562495e9430a9edbbe1b5d3b9c8:0
- value
- 8042090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d400d57ba91d683c5d3e061f3460651ba990dbf OP_EQUAL
- address
- 38jUgjXTCRHkeADriz4jCtaWzdAsj8r3pz